概述

全球紡織化學品市場2023年達235億美元,預計2031年將達332億美元,2024-2031年預測期間複合年成長率為4.4%。

日益成長的生活方式,特別是在發展中國家和已開發國家,鼓勵了用於室內裝飾、服裝、地板覆蓋物和家居用品的紡織品的製造,從而促進了市場擴張。由於紡織品生產和消費的增加,化學品現在被用作補充原料。紡織品製造需要使用多種化學品。

據美國化學理事會稱,由於汽車、建築和消費品行業對化學品的需求不斷成長,預計美國化學行業的銷量將會增加。公司正在製定策略以滿足市場需求並擴大其影響力。例如,2021 年 6 月,Archroma 與該國專業原料經銷商 Van Horn, Metz & Co. Inc. 合作,分銷 Mowilith 乳液。

到2023年,北美預計將成為第二主導地區,佔全球紡織化學品市場的20%以上。儘管該地區的勞動力和原料成本較高,但美國的時尚和服裝產業卻蓬勃發展。全國服裝設計師企業整體數量較去年同期成長約5%。此外,根據美國商務部和 OTEXA 的數據,多年來,該國的服裝貿易有所改善,2021 年出口額達到 850.07 億美元。

環境和健康問題

紡織化學品業務受到旨在減少污染和危險廢物的嚴格環境限制。大約 10-15% 的染料被排放到廢水中,導致令人不快且顏色深的外觀。含有醋酸、硫酸等基本化學物質的染料有可能污染土地、空氣和水。紡織業的廢水被認為是所有工業部門中污染最嚴重的。

含有染料的廢水會吸收光,干擾水生動物的光合作用。它擾亂了水資源生態系統。此外,這些有害化合物在與人體皮膚長時間接觸後會被吸收到皮膚中,並可能導致皮膚過敏和其他危險情況。如果在紡織品製造過程中沒有採取適當的防護措施,這些有毒化學物質可能會導致呼吸道和皮膚疾病。因此,這些化合物受到嚴格的監管。

Overview

Global Textile Chemicals Market reached US$ 23.5 billion in 2023 and is expected to reach US$ 33.2 billion by 2031, growing with a CAGR of 4.4% during the forecast period 2024-2031.

The growing lifestyle, particularly in developing and developed countries, has encouraged the manufacturing of textiles used for upholstery, clothing, floor coverings, and home furnishings, hence boosting market expansion. Chemicals are now being used as supplementary raw materials as a result of increased textile production and consumption. Textile manufacture necessitates the use of a wide variety of chemicals.

In accordance with the American Chemistry Council, the chemical sector in the U.S. is predicted to rise in volume due to rising demand for chemicals from the automotive, construction, and consumer goods industries. Companies are developing strategies to suit market demands and expand their presence. For instance, in June 2021, Archroma teamed with Van Horn, Metz & Co. Inc., a specialist raw material distributor in the country, to distribute Mowilith emulsions.

In 2023, North America is expected to be the second-dominant region with over 20% of the global textile chemicals market. Despite the region's high labor and raw material costs, the U.S. has a booming fashion and garment sector. The country's overall number of fashion designer enterprises increased by about 5% year on year. Furthermore, the country has improved its clothes trade over the years, completing the year 2021 with US$ 85,007 million in export value, according to the U.S. Department of Commerce and OTEXA.

Environmental and Health Concerns

The textile chemicals business is subject to stringent environmental restrictions designed to reduce pollution and hazardous waste. About 10-15% of dyes are discharged into wastewater, leading to an unpleasant and highly colored appearance. Dyes containing basic chemicals like acetic acid, sulfuric acid, and others have the potential to contaminate land, air, and water. The textile industry's effluent is considered the most polluting of all industrial sectors.

Dye-containing wastewater absorbs light, interfering with photosynthesis in aquatic animals. It disturbs the water resource ecosystem. Furthermore, these harmful compounds are absorbed into the skin after prolonged contact with human skin and they can cause skin allergies and other dangerous conditions. If proper safeguards are not taken during textile manufacturing, these toxic chemicals can cause respiratory and skin diseases. As a result, these compounds are subject to severe regulations.

Segment Analysis

The global textile chemicals market is segmented based on type, application, and region.

Rising Demand in Every Stage of Fashion & Clothing Drives Segment Growth

Fashion & Clothing is expected to be the dominant segment with over 30% of the market during the forecast period 2024-2031. Consumers' exposure to the internet and e-commerce has expanded their fashion awareness and access to high-end brands and limited-edition products. The pressure to evolve from the segment improves the textile chemical market by increasing consumption.

Furthermore, clothing is a major export commodity in many countries. According to the International Labour Organization, developing nations produce more than 60% of global apparel exports, with Asia-Pacific making up 32% of the total. China, the largest apparel market in the Asia-Pacific, recorded a 17.35% increase in garment export shipments worth US$ 189.35 billion in the first seven months of 2022, according to the General Administration of Customs China.

Geographical Penetration

Presence of Matured Textile Industries in Asia-Pacific

Asia-Pacific is expected to be the dominant region in the global textile chemicals market covering over 35% of the market. China has the world's largest textile sector in terms of both output and export volume. China's textile sector expanded in the first nine months of 2022, according to the Ministry of Sector and Information Technology. The aggregate operational revenue of large textile firms in China increased by 3.1% year on year, reaching US$ 570 billion during that time.

In accordance with IBEF, the Indian textile and apparel sector is expected to reach US$ 190 billion by 2025-2026. India accounts for 4% of the global textile and clothing trade. In FY 2022, India's textile and apparel exports totaled US$ 44.4 billion, a 41% rise year over year. Thus, increased investments and improvements in the textile industry are expected to help textile chemical growth.

COVID-19 Impact Analysis

Lockdowns and restrictions disrupted the production and transfer of raw materials required for textile chemicals, resulting in shortages and delays. Restrictions on movement and transit, port closures, and limited shipping capacity resulted in severe delays and increased prices for moving products. Many chemical manufacturing plants had temporary closures or decreased operations due to lockdowns, social distancing restrictions, and worker shortages.

Textile demand fell substantially as consumers reduced their expenditure on non-essential items and retail establishments closed. It had a direct impact on the need for textile chemicals. There was a shift in demand for personal protective equipment (PPE), masks, and medical textiles, which resulted in a brief spike in demand for particular textile chemicals. As more individuals stayed at home, there was an increased demand for home textiles like bedding, upholstery, and loungewear, which partly offset the fall in garment demand.

Russia-Ukraine War Impact

Ukraine and Russia are key raw material suppliers, including chemicals for the textile sector. The conflict has affected the supply of key commodities, resulting in shortages and higher pricing. The war has disrupted transportation lines such as road, rail, and sea, making it difficult to convey raw materials and finished products efficiently. Ports and shipping waterways have been impacted, resulting in delays and rising shipping prices.

Russia is a major exporter of oil & gas. The conflict caused global energy costs to rise, hurting the cost of producing textile chemicals, which require a lot of energy to create. Rising energy costs and supply chain interruptions have led to broader inflationary pressures, raising the overall cost of textile chemicals and affecting manufacturers' profit margins.

Key Developments

  • In April 2022, Cosmo Speciality Chemicals introduced the Wetofast series, an environmentally friendly option for maintaining fabric quality. The line includes three new models: Wetofast GN, Wetofast LOR, and Wetofast LD.
  • In February 2021, Kemin Industries, a global ingredient maker, stated that its business unit, Garmon Chemicals, unveiled Kemzymes, a new spectrum of enzymes designed for garment washing.
  • In November 2021, Fineotex Chemical opened a new factory in Ambernath, India. The new manufacturing base is a crucial step in boosting the company's competitive position at both the local and international levels.
